Prepare Like a Pro: Tips for Efficient/Successful/Smooth Move-Day Success

Moving can be a daunting task, but with a little planning and preparation, you can make the process much smoother. One of the most important aspects of a successful move is packing efficiently. By following these tips, you can ensure that your belongings are packed securely and organized for a stress-free moving day. First and foremost, initiate by decluttering your home. Get rid of/Donate/Sell anything you no longer need or use. This will not only reduce the amount of stuff you have to pack but also save you time and effort in the long run. Once you've decluttered, assemble all of your packing supplies, including boxes, tape, bubble wrap, and packing paper.

  • Mark your boxes clearly with their contents and destination room. This will make it much easier to unpack once you arrive at your new home.
  • Fill heavier items in smaller boxes and lighter items in larger boxes.
  • Protect fragile items carefully with bubble wrap or packing paper.
  • Utilize/Employ/Leverage wardrobe boxes for hanging clothes to save space and stop wrinkles.

Remember to pack a separate box with essentials that you'll need immediately upon arrival, such as toiletries, medications, and a change of clothes. This will help you feel more settled in your new home right away. By following these tips, you can guarantee that your move is as efficient and successful as possible.
